2011 GHS to RSD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the GHS to RSD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 10, valuing the pair at 55.6095.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 5, dropping to 43.9584.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 11.6510 RSD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 52.2303 to the December average rate of 47.6603, the exchange rate registered a net change of -8.75%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 55.6095 was down 8.37% compared to the 2010 peak of 60.6873,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 55.6095 48.8225 52.2303
February 55.3415 47.7413 50.2285
March 49.7503 47.1743 48.2935
April 48.3721 44.5961 46.4370
May 46.6390 43.9584 45.2360
June 47.0602 44.1003 45.6082
July 48.3973 45.3787 47.1159
August 47.6514 45.7421 46.6794
September 48.5228 45.7214 46.9425
October 47.7358 44.0340 45.3714
November 47.3318 45.6410 46.6312
December 49.8654 46.6928 47.6603
